At that time you won’t need to ask me for anything, for you can go directly to the Father and ask him, and he will give you what you ask for because you use my name. You haven’t tried this before, but begin now. Ask, using my name, and you will receive, and your cup of joy will overflow – John 16:23-24 (TLB).

If there’s anything you desire, you can put your faith to work today for a miracle. You can ask the Father in the Name of Jesus, and receive the answer! The Lord doesn’t want you sad, bitter or frustrated in life. If that has been your experience, it’s time for a change. It’s a new day; the beginning of a new year, and you can make it glorious. You can create a new destiny for yourself, because God wants your joy to be full, not sometimes, but always. That’s why He gave you an open invitation to ask anything in the Name of Jesus and expect answers: “For every one that asketh receiveth…” (Matthew 7:8).

Not only is the Lord able, He’s equally willing to grant any request you make of Him. No wonder Jesus, with excitement and assurance said in Luke 11:9, “…Ask and it shall be given you….” God is a giver; He gives generously and graciously to all without holding back (James 1:5). Romans 8:32 says, “He that spared not his own Son, but delivered him up for us all, how shall he not with him also freely give us all things?” This describes your heavenly Father’s liberality and benevolence towards you! He doesn’t consider anything too good for you. The Bible says He gives us richly all things to enjoy (1 Timothy 6:17).

Yours is to act on His open invitation by asking in the Name of Jesus, and receive. Jesus said in Luke 12:32 “Fear not, little flock; for it is your Father’s good pleasure to give you the kingdom.” It delights the Lord to bless you and do you good. The Scripture says that He daily loads us with benefits (Psalm 68:19).

Always remember that the Lord is interested in you; it’s His joy to answer your prayers and grant you your heart’s desires. John 15:7 says “If ye abide in me, and my words abide in you, ye shall ask what ye will, and it shall be done unto you.” This is your assurance—abiding in Him, and His Word abiding in you—therefore whatever you ask in prayer, believing, you’ll receive, and your cup of joy will overflow!
